Just a quick question.
Is there any way to run two world editors at the same time?
It would make things about a thousand times easier.

I don't know of a way to run two World Editors, since it won't open a second if one's already open. You can have multiple maps open in the same World Editor.

Open World Editor, Open map1, Open map2, and you have 2 maps open at once. To switch between them go to Window and click on the map that doesn't have check next to it.
